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
|
Дәріс 11 ЭЕМ процессорларыПроцессор – ЭЕМ құрылғысы, ақпаратты берілген алгоритмге сәйкес түрлендіруге арналған. Жіктелуі. 1. тағайындалуы бойынша: - әмбебап – Басқаруды реттеу және барлық ЭЕМ-ді бақылау үшін белгіленген (орталық процессор – СРИ); - мамандандырылған – тапсырманың белгілі бір класын (бір тапсырманы) шешуге арналған. 2. ішкі жұмысы бойынша: - конвейерлік типті – конаейерлерді ұйымдастырудың екі типі болуы мүмкін: * процессор орындайтын операциялар топтарға біріккен, операцияның әр тобын орындау үшін жеке блок болады. Блоктар бір-бірімен тізбектей орналасқан және конвейер түзеді; * ЭЕМ-нің бір типті процессорлары конвейерге ұйымдастырылған (АС-те – 2 конвейер); - векторлық типті – бір программа бойынша бір мезгілде бірнеше параметрлерді өңдеуге мүмкіндік береді; - ассоциативтітипті – символдық ақпараттың үлкен массивін өңдеуге арналған (АЕСҚ негізінде құрылған). Қазіргі компьютерлерде процессор құрамына арифметикалық-логикалық құрылғылар (АЛҚ) және орталық басқару құрылғысы (ОБҚ) кіреді. Процессордың жалпылама құрылымдық сұлбасы
– сурет. Процессордың жалпы құрылымдық сұлбасы
АЛҚ – арифметикалық-логикалық құрылғы; ОБҚ –орталық басқару құрылғысы: СБ – синхрондау блогы; КББ – команданы басқару блогы; ОББ –операцияны басқару блогы; БР – басқару регистрлері: - Программаның күй сөзі (органдар регистрі); - регистр/командалар санағышы; - маскалар регистрі және т.б.; ӨЖЖЕСҚ (стек); ЖББ – жадымен байланысу блогы. Арифметикалық-логикалық құрылғы. Мыналарды орындауға арналған: - арифметикалық операцияларды; - логикалық операцияларды; - жылжыту операциясын; - алфавитті-цифрлық өрістермен операциялар. Жіктелуі: 1. ақпарат алмасу тәсілі бойынша: - тізбекті (тізбекті-параллельді); - параллельді (параллельді-тізбекті); 2. деректерді көрсету формасы бойынша: - тиянақты үтірлі сандар үшін; - жылжымалы үтірлі сандар үшін; - ондық цифрларды өңдеу үшін; 3. санау жүйесі бойынша: - Екілік санау жүйесінде; - Ондық санау жүйесінде; - Қалған класты санау жүйелерінде; - Фибоначчи жүйесінде; 4. құрылымы бойынша: - әмбебап, командалар жүйесінің барлық операциялары бір ғана блоктың қатысуымен орындалады; - конвейерлік – АЛҚ блоктарға бөлінген (тізбекті жалғанған), әр блок командалар жүйесінен ұқсас бірнеше (бір операцияның көлемінде) операцияларды орындайды.
2.36 – сурет. АЛҚ-ң жалпы құрылымдық сұлбасы
ІРБ (ӨЖЖЕСҚ) – ішкі регистрлер блогы – АЛҚ-гың регистрлері –операндаларды және аралық нәтижелерді уақытша сақтауға арналған (команданың орындалу периодында); ОБ – операциялар блогы (өңдеу блогы) – деректерді нақты орындау блогы. - логикалық ақпарат (процессорда) - тиянақты үтірлі сандар (процессорда) - жылжымалы үтірлі сандар (сопроцессорда) - ондық сандар (сопроцессорда) БжДБ- бақылау және диагностикалау блогы;
|